In my report, the platelet distribution width is 16.2 percent and the mean platelet volume is 7.2 fL. Can I know if there is any problem?
Answered by 1 Apollo Doctors
Both values are slightly outside the usual range but not necessarily alarming. A low MPV may be seen in some platelet disorders or mild infections. If you have no bleeding or clotting issues, it is not urgent. Please consult a doctor to interpret it in the context of your full blood count and symptoms.
